Evidence shows that deviating from a predominantly plant-based diet is a major factor in the development of heart disease, cancer, strokes, arthritis, and many other chronic degenerative diseases. Conversely these plant based foods can aid and enhance the body’s natural healing capacities. Learn about the power of food. Reversing the food pyramid is the key to good health. The benefits of a diet rich in fruits and vegetables and other healing foods is so strong that it has been endorsed by U.S. government health agencies and by virtually every major medical organization, including the American Cancer Society. This wealth of evidence-based information supports that a diet of whole food creates lasting health benefits.
